I have Blackberry Bliss in marker format only, so I scribbled on a piece of wax paper, then used an aquapainter to pick that ink up to paint with. I used this same method with my Mossy Meadow marker. I stamped the sentiment by coloring on my stamp with my BB marker, huffing, then stamping. I just realized my ribbon is Rich Razzleberry, though!
